Out of Bounds Tip of the Week
3 for All Improvisers Rafe Chase, Stephen Kearin, and Tim Orr "create a unique blend of intensely dramatic and outrageously funny, completely improvised scenes based on audience suggestions." (from the Out of Bounds website). Although we haven't seen them in the flesh, Time Out New York (stalwarts of all things big city culture) said they "single-handedly restored my faith in improv comedy." And the Big Apple doesn't mess with fluff praise, y'all. They were wearing gauchos before the got all popular again OK? Think about it.

Sunday, September 3rd
7:30pm @ Esther's Pool
Playing with Available Cupholders (Austin) and Dasariski (Los Angeles/Chicago - we raved on about these personal favorites a few weeks back).
